This print showcases a remarkable portrait of Patrice de Mac Mahon, the esteemed Marshal of France in 1859. Known as the Duke of Magenta and later serving as President of the Republic from 1873 to 1879, Mac Mahon was a prominent figure in French history. The painting, created by Emile Horace Vernet in 1860, beautifully captures his dignified presence. The composition exudes an air of authority and strength, reflecting Mac Mahon's role as a representative at the Battle of Magenta on June 4th, 1859. Vernet's masterful brushstrokes bring out every detail with precision and finesse. Displayed at the Musee et Domaine National de Versailles et de Trianon in Versailles, France, this artwork is a testament to both military prowess and artistic excellence. Measuring approximately 2x1.43 meters, it commands attention within its gallery space.
